WebMar 3, 2024 · INTRODUCTION. Atypical glandular cells (AGC) on cervical cytology usually originate from the glandular epithelium of the endocervix or endometrium. They are a less common finding than abnormal squamous cells. Patients with AGC require further evaluation for premalignant conditions of the cervix, uterus, and, rarely, ovary and fallopian tube.
